What is a Foldable Mobility Scooter?
Foldable mobility scooters are compact, lightweight scooters that can be easily folded and kept. They are particularly popular among those who require a mobility aid that can be carried in cars and trucks, trains, or airplanes. These scooters use the same fundamental performances as traditional mobility scooters however included included benefits related to reduce of transport.

Are foldable mobility scooters ideal for outside usage?
Yes, the majority of foldable mobility scooters are designed to deal with different surfaces, though it's a good idea to inspect the specs for each design.
2. Do I need a driving license to operate a mobility scooter?
No, a driving license is not required for mobility scooter users in the UK, although appropriate understanding of traffic rules is essential.
3. Can I take a foldable mobility scooter on public transport?
Yes, foldable mobility scooters are permitted on public transport, but it's vital to contact specific transportation providers for their policies.
4. What is the average cost of a foldable mobility scooter in the UK?
Rates generally range from ₤ 500 to ₤ 2,500 depending upon the model and features.
